Figure 4.

The intracellular tails of PD-1 and BTLA dictate their specificities. (A) Cartoon depicting a Raji-Jurkat co-culture assay in which Jurkat (PD-1FF–mGFP+), Jurkat (PD-1WT–mGFP+), or Jurkat (PD-1ECTO-TMD–BTLAINT-mGFP+) cells were stimulated with SEE-loaded Raji (PD-L1–mCherry+) cells. (B) Flow cytometry histograms showing PD-1 levels on indicated Jurkat T cells. (C) Representative IBs of phosphotyrosine (pY IB), GFP (GFP IB), and the coprecipitated SHP1 and SHP2 of immunoprecipitated GFP-tagged receptors. (DF) Same as A–C, except replacing Raji (PD-L1–mCherry+), Jurkat (PD-1FF–mGFP+), Jurkat (PD-1WT–mGFP+), and Jurkat (PD-1ECTO-TMD–BTLAINT-mGFP+) cells with Raji (HVEM-mRuby+), Jurkat (BTLAFFFF-mGFP+), Jurkat (BTLAWT-mGFP+), and Jurkat (BTLAECTO-TMD–PD-1INT–mGFP+) cells, respectively. WCL, whole cell lysate.
